What Are Cookies
Cookies are small text files that are stored on your device when you visit a website. They are widely used to make websites work more efficiently, provide a better user experience, and give website owners information about how their site is being used.
Cookies can be session cookies, which are deleted when you close your browser, or persistent cookies, which remain on your device for a set period or until you delete them.
